Agreements between Simon Fraser and Roderick Mackenzie
Part of Masson Collection
Includes a notarized agreement (1808) between Simon Fraser and Roderick Mackenzie for building a house at Terrebonne and a second notarized agreement regarding an expedition (1809).

Part of Percy Erskine Nobbs Fonds
Album of black and white photographs depicts interior and exteriors of the Strathearn School, Edward VII School, Peace Centennial School, L. & L. & G. Building, the new Birks Building, the Regina War Memorial Museum, one photograph of the Bancroft School, as well many photographs of University of Alberta buildings. Photos are accompanied by handwritten labels and stickers indicating op. numbers.
